/* PROTO */
void
getmessage(void *c, const char *who, const int automessage, const char *message)
{
	const char	*msgin = message;
	char           *msg = NULL, *tempmsg = NULL;

	char           *sname;
	struct Waiting *wtemp, *wptr = NULL;
	int             offset, foundWaiting = 0;

	int otr_message = 0;
	if (conn->otr) {
		struct BuddyList	*buddy = NULL;
		buddy = find_buddy(who);

		if (buddy) {
			if (buddy->otr != -1) {
				char *newmsg;
				int ret = otrl_message_receiving(userstate, &ui_ops, NULL, conn->username,
								otr_proto, buddy->sn, msgin, &newmsg, NULL,
								&buddy->otr_context, NULL, NULL);
				if (ret) {
#ifdef DEBUG
					b_echostr_s();
					printf("[OTR] debug: internal msg %s\n", msgin);
#endif
					return;
				} else {
					if (newmsg) {
						msgin = strdup(newmsg);
						otrl_message_free(newmsg);
	                                        if (buddy->otr_context->msgstate == OTRL_MSGSTATE_ENCRYPTED)
							otr_message = 1;
					}
				}
			}
		}
	}

	tempmsg = strip_html(msgin);

	
	if (tempmsg == NULL)
		return;
	if (strlen(tempmsg) == 0) {
		free(tempmsg);
		return;
	}
	if (conn->netspeak_filter) {
		msg = undo_netspeak(tempmsg);
		free(tempmsg);
	} else {
		msg = tempmsg;
	}

	if (msg == NULL)
		return;

	if (strlen(msg) == 0) {
		free(msg);
		return;
	}
	if (conn->istyping == 0) {
		if (conn->lastsn != NULL)
			free(conn->lastsn);
		conn->lastsn = simplify_sn(who);
	}
	sname = simplify_sn(who);

	if (waiting == NULL) {
		waiting = malloc(sizeof(struct Waiting));
		wptr = waiting;
	} else {
		for (wtemp = waiting; wtemp != NULL; wtemp = wtemp->next)
			if (imcomm_compare_nicks(c, wtemp->sn, who)) {
				foundWaiting = 1;
				wptr = wtemp;
				break;
			}
		if (!foundWaiting) {
			for (wtemp = waiting; wtemp->next != NULL;
			     wtemp = wtemp->next);
			wtemp->next = malloc(sizeof(struct Waiting));
			wptr = wtemp->next;
		}
	}

	if (!foundWaiting) {
		wptr->sn = strdup(who);
		wptr->next = NULL;

		if (conn->isaway && !automessage) {
			if ((conn->respond_idle_only && conn->isidle)
			    || (!conn->respond_idle_only)) {
				imcomm_im_send_message(c, who, conn->awaymsg, 1);
				eraseline();
				b_echostr_s();

				if (conn->timestamps) {
					addts();
					putchar(' ');
				}
				printf("Sent auto-response to %s.\n", who);
				show_prompt();
			}
		}
	}
#ifdef MESSAGE_QUEUE
	if (conn->isaway)
		wptr->mqueue = addToMQueue(wptr->mqueue, msg, who);
#endif				/* MESSAGE_QUEUE */


	eraseline();

	if (conn->bell_on_incoming)
		putchar('\a');

	if (conn->timestamps) {
		addts();
		putchar(' ');
		offset = 11;
	} else {
		offset = 0;
	}

	offset += strlen(who) + 2;
	if (automessage) {
		set_color(COLOR_AUTORESPONSE);
		printf("*AUTO RESPONSE* ");
		set_color(0);
		offset += 16;
	}
	set_color(COLOR_INCOMING_IM);
	if (!otr_message)
		printf("%s", who);
	else {
		offset += 5;
		printf("(otr)%s", who);
	}
	set_color(0);
	printf(": ");
	wordwrap_print(msg, offset);
	if (automessage)
		log_event(EVENT_IM_AUTORESPONSE, sname, msg);
	else
		log_event(EVENT_IM, sname, msg);

	free(msg);
	free(sname);
	show_prompt();
}

/* PROTO */
void
input_paste(char *arg)
{
	char           *sn, *sendbuf, *pbuf;
	size_t          sendbuflen;
	ssize_t         pbuflen;
	uint16_t        maxmsgsize = imcomm_get_max_message_size(conn->conn);

	if (conn->conn == NULL)
		return;

	sn = arg;

	if (sn[0] == 0) {
		printf("\n");
		b_echostr_s();
		printf("No recipient specified.\n");
		return;
	}
	printf("\n");
	b_echostr_s();
	printf("Pasting to %s.\n", sn);
	b_echostr_s();
	printf("Enter '.' on a line by itself to send," " Ctrl-X to cancel.");

	pbuf = malloc(maxmsgsize + 1);
	sendbuf = malloc(maxmsgsize + 1);
	memset(sendbuf, 0, maxmsgsize + 1);

	sendbuflen = 0;

	/*
         * using fgets() produced strange results. had to resort to writing
         * my own input stuff.
         */

	while (1) {
		printf("\n-> ");
		fflush(stdout);

		pbuflen = bsf_getline(pbuf, maxmsgsize - 5);

		if (pbuflen == -1) {
			free(pbuf);
			free(sendbuf);
			printf("\n");
			return;
		}
		if (pbuflen == 1 && pbuf[0] == '.') {
			if (sendbuflen > 0) {
				imcomm_im_send_message(conn->conn, sn, sendbuf, 0);
			}
			break;
		}
		/*
	         * +4 is for "<br>"
	         */

		if (sendbuflen + pbuflen + 4 > maxmsgsize) {
			imcomm_im_send_message(conn->conn, sn, sendbuf, 0);
			memset(sendbuf, 0, maxmsgsize + 1);

			memcpy(sendbuf, pbuf, pbuflen);
			sendbuflen = pbuflen;
		} else {
#ifdef __OpenBSD__
			if (sendbuflen != 0) {
				strlcat(sendbuf, "<br>", maxmsgsize + 1);
				pbuflen += 4;
			}
			strlcat(sendbuf, pbuf, maxmsgsize + 1);
#else
			if (sendbuflen != 0) {
				strcat(sendbuf, "<br>");
				pbuflen += 4;
			}
			strcat(sendbuf, pbuf);
#endif
			sendbuflen += pbuflen;
		}
	}

	printf("\n");

	free(sendbuf);
	free(pbuf);
}

status_t
AIMProtocol::Process(BMessage* msg)
{
	switch (msg->what) {
		case IM_MESSAGE: {
			int32 im_what = 0;
 
			msg->FindInt32("im_what", &im_what);

			switch (im_what) {
				case IM_SET_OWN_STATUS: {
					int32 status = msg->FindInt32("status");

					BString status_msg("");
					msg->FindString("message", &status_msg);
					char* smsg = strdup(status_msg.String());

					switch (status) {
						case CAYA_ONLINE:
							if (!fOnline)
								A_LogOn();
							else
								imcomm_set_unaway(fIMCommHandle);
							break;
						case CAYA_AWAY:
							imcomm_set_away(fIMCommHandle, smsg);
							break;
						case CAYA_CUSTOM_STATUS:
							//imcomm_set_away(fIMCommHandle, smsg);
							//UnsupportedOperation(); ?
							break;
						case CAYA_DO_NOT_DISTURB:
							imcomm_set_away(fIMCommHandle, smsg);
							//UnsupportedOperation(); ?
							break;
						case CAYA_OFFLINE:
							LogOff();
							break;
						default:
							break;
					}

					free(smsg);

					BMessage msg(IM_MESSAGE);
					msg.AddInt32("im_what", IM_STATUS_SET);
					msg.AddString("protocol", kProtocolSignature);
					msg.AddInt32("status", status);
					gServerMsgr->SendMessage(&msg);
					break;
				}
				case IM_SET_NICKNAME:
					UnsupportedOperation();
					break;
				case IM_SEND_MESSAGE: {
					const char* buddy = msg->FindString("id");
					const char* sms = msg->FindString("body");
					imcomm_im_send_message(fIMCommHandle, buddy, sms, 0);

					// XXX send a message to let caya know we did it
					BMessage msg(IM_MESSAGE);
					msg.AddInt32("im_what", IM_MESSAGE_SENT);
					msg.AddString("protocol", kProtocolSignature);
					msg.AddString("id", buddy);
					msg.AddString("body", sms);

					gServerMsgr->SendMessage(&msg);
					break;
				}
				case IM_REGISTER_CONTACTS: {
					const char* buddy = NULL;
					char *buddy_copy;

					for (int32 i = 0; msg->FindString("id", i, &buddy) == B_OK; i++) {
						buddy_copy = strdup(buddy);
						imcomm_im_add_buddy(fIMCommHandle, buddy_copy);
						free(buddy_copy);
					}
					break;
				}
				case IM_UNREGISTER_CONTACTS: {
					const char* buddy = NULL;

					for (int32 i = 0; msg->FindString("id", i, &buddy) == B_OK; i++)
						imcomm_im_remove_buddy(fIMCommHandle, buddy);
					break;
				}
				case IM_USER_STARTED_TYPING:
					//UnsupportedOperation();
					break;
				case IM_USER_STOPPED_TYPING:
					//UnsupportedOperation();
					break;
				case IM_GET_CONTACT_INFO:
					UnsupportedOperation();
					break;
				case IM_ASK_AUTHORIZATION:
				case IM_AUTHORIZATION_RECEIVED:
				case IM_AUTHORIZATION_REQUEST:
				case IM_AUTHORIZATION_RESPONSE:
				case IM_CONTACT_AUTHORIZED:
					UnsupportedOperation();
					break;
				case IM_SPECIAL_TO_PROTOCOL:
						UnsupportedOperation();
					break;
				default:
					return B_ERROR;
			}
			break;
		}
		default:
			// We don't handle this what code
			return B_ERROR;
	}

    return B_OK;
}

/* PROTO */
void
input_send_message(char *arg)
{
	char           *msg, *msg_strip, *temp, *sn;
	char           *fullmsg;
	size_t          fullmsg_len;
	int             offset;

	if (conn->conn == NULL)
		return;

	temp = strchr(arg, ' ');

	if (temp == NULL) {
		printf("\n");
		b_echostr_s();
		printf("No message to send.\n");
		return;
	}
	if (strlen(temp + 1) == 0) {
		printf("\nNo message to send.\n");
		return;
	}
	if (conn->netspeak_filter)
		msg = undo_netspeak(temp + 1);
	else
		msg = temp + 1;

	sn = malloc(temp - arg + 1);
	sn[temp - arg] = 0;
	strncpy(sn, arg, temp - arg);
	fullmsg_len =
		strlen(msg) + strlen(SEND_FORMAT_BEGIN) + strlen(SEND_FORMAT_END) +
		1;
	fullmsg = malloc(fullmsg_len + 1);
	snprintf(fullmsg, fullmsg_len, "%s%s%s", SEND_FORMAT_BEGIN, msg,
		 SEND_FORMAT_END);
	imcomm_im_send_message(conn->conn, sn, fullmsg, 0);
	free(fullmsg);
	eraseline();

	if (conn->timestamps) {
		addts();
		putchar(' ');
		offset = 13;
	} else {
		offset = 2;
	}

	offset += strlen(sn) + 2;
	set_color(COLOR_OUTGOING_IM);
	printf("->%s", sn);
	set_color(0);
	printf(": ");
	msg_strip = strip_html(msg);
	wordwrap_print(msg_strip, offset);
	free(msg_strip);

	if (conn->lastsn != NULL)
		free(conn->lastsn);

	conn->lastsn = strdup(sn);
	log_event(EVENT_IMSEND, sn, msg);
	free(sn);

	if (conn->netspeak_filter)
		free(msg);
}
